About this property

Sequoia National Forrest CabinG sleeps 16

Family friendly cabinet 5,800' in the Sequoias with 3 bedrooms and two full bathrooms, large deck with BBQ's and plenty of room for large groups or small. We have ATVs available for rent also and sleds for winter months to play on the old ski hill. We have a smaller cabin next door we rent also in case your interested in larger groups or just more room. $25 per person per night after four.

We are close to some Giant Redwoods like "Trail of 100 Giants" and others as well as close to some cool hiking trails as well as driving trails. We can send more details or feel free to ask us any questions you may have
Please realize WiFi in the mountains is from a satellite dish and not very good for streaming
Please also realize although we clean thoroughly we also run fans in the summer to cool down the cabin so there may be light dust still.

Great Off the Grid Retreat
This was just what we needed to get off the internet and into nature. Not fancy but has what you need to enjoy mountains, trees, stars, and gorgeous views. One word of caution for city folk: make sure you get specific directions from the owners before you start driving, print out your maps, and arrive while it’s light out with time to spare. It is hard to find, like most of the cabins around it. Our internet nav took us to the wrong place and we didn’t have any cell signal or WiFi so it was an adventure to find the cabin - the owner had texted me directions but I didn’t get them before losing service.
